Biotech refers to the use of biological processes, organisms, or systems to develop products or technologies that improve human health. Biopharma, on the other hand, focuses on the development and production of pharmaceutical drugs using biotechnological processes. Together, these two sectors play a crucial role in the development of new drugs, treatments, and therapies that have the potential to save lives and improve quality of life for patients around the world.
One of the key advantages of biotech and biopharma is the ability to tailor treatments to individual patients based on their specific genetic makeup. This personalized medicine approach allows for more targeted and effective treatments, reducing the likelihood of adverse reactions and improving overall patient outcomes. By leveraging the latest advancements in genomics and molecular biology, biotech and biopharma companies are able to develop customized therapies that address the unique needs of each patient.

Furthermore, biotech and biopharma are driving innovation in the field of immunotherapy – a groundbreaking approach to treating cancer by harnessing the body’s own immune system to target and destroy cancer cells. Immunotherapy has shown great promise in the treatment of various types of cancer, offering new hope for patients who may have exhausted traditional treatment options. By developing new immunotherapies and personalized cancer treatments, biotech and biopharma are at the forefront of the fight against cancer.
The advancement of biotech and biopharma has also led to significant improvements in drug discovery and development processes. Technology such as high-throughput screening, bioinformatics, and artificial intelligence are being used to expedite the drug development pipeline, reducing the time and cost associated with bringing new medications to market. This has enabled biotech and biopharma companies to develop and launch innovative therapies more quickly, providing patients with access to new treatment options sooner.
Moreover, biotech and biopharma are driving progress in the field of regenerative medicine – a multidisciplinary approach to repairing, replacing, or regenerating damaged tissues and organs. This innovative field holds great promise for the treatment of conditions such as heart disease, diabetes, and spinal cord injuries, offering hope for patients who may have previously faced limited treatment options. By developing new regenerative therapies, biotech and biopharma are opening up new possibilities for patients with chronic and degenerative diseases.
